1. What is the National Flag of India?
The national flag of India is 'Tiranga', in which saffron symbolizes courage, white symbolizes peace and green symbolizes prosperity. The Ashoka Chakra present in the middle represents religion and progress.
2. What is the National Emblem of the country?
'Ashoka Pillar' (Lion Capital of Ashoka) is the national symbol of India, which you must have seen on notes and coins. It is taken from the Ashoka Pillar of Sarnath. 'Satyamev Jayate' is also written on it, which is our national motto.
3. What is our national anthem?
Our national anthem is 'Jana Gana Mana', which we all must have sung in schools. It was written by Gurudev Rabindranath Tagore and is sung in 52 seconds.
4. What is the name of the National Song of India?
'Vande Mataram' is the national song of India, which was written by Bankim Chandra Chatterjee. 150 years have passed since this song was composed. Mother India has been praised in this song.
5. What is called the national animal of the country?
The king of the jungle may be the lion, but when it comes to the national animal, it is the 'Royal Bengal Tiger'. The tiger is known for its strength, agility and power.
6. Who is our national bird?
We all know this question. We have been taught about this since childhood. 'Peacock' is our national bird and it has got this status because of its beauty and grandeur.
7. What is the name of the national flower of India?
Lotus flower is called our national flower. This flower teaches a lesson to everyone. Just as a flower maintains its purity despite blooming in the mud, similarly we should maintain our life and conduct. Because of this specialty, this flower is an important part of our culture.
8. Do you know which is the national tree of India?
Very few people would know that the national tree of India is 'Banyan Tree'. It is considered a symbol of immortality due to its huge branches and long lifespan.
9. What is called the national fruit of the country?
You will be surprised to know that Mango, which is called the king of fruits, is also the national fruit of our country.
10. What is the name of the national river of India?
You will be surprised to know that Ganga, which washes away sins, which is considered the most sacred in Hindu religion, is also the national river of our country.
